Transaction 003d7f229ca13aba92aaa89dfdf4184775dd34e3955a95f672cc0d9fdea3a7f7

block
723b22c09c29bba78ab94d08dd8e626f477f0e98cdee93cb24ed9794d4f57a96

1 Input

1021 Outputs